Vuls is an agentless vulnerability scanner and CVE intelligence aggregator. It identifies security flaws in operating systems, containers, and network devices without requiring the installation of permanent software agents on target machines. The project distinguishes itself by cross-referencing software versions against multiple vulnerability databases, security advisories, and known exploit catalogs. itpol is a framework for cryptographic key management, digital signature policies, and security hardening. It provides an IT policy template library and infrastructure access frameworks to establish organizational security guidelines and governance. The project focuses on cryptographic identity management through the use of PGP and SSH keys, alongside a security hardening guide for workstations.
